Prothioconazole is a member of the class of triazoles that is 1,2,4-triazole-3-thione substituted at position 2 by a 2-(1-chlorocyclopropyl)-3-(2-chlorophenyl)-2-hydroxypropyl group. It is a member of monochlorobenzenes, a tertiary alcohol, a member of cyclopropanes and a thiocarbonyl compound.
